Qatari Foreign Minister Mohammed bin Abdulrahman Al-Thani will arrive in Lebanon at 5pm Tuesday on a one-day official visit, the Qatari embassy said on Monday.

The minister will hold separate meetings with President Michel Aoun, Parliament Speaker Nabih Berri, Prime Minister-designate Saad Hariri and Army Commander General Joseph Aoun, the embassy added in a statement.

Earlier in the day, the Qatari government-funded Al-Jazeera TV said the visit is “part of Qatar’s efforts to help resolve the political crisis in Lebanon.”

Qatar’s ruling emir,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al-Thani, had in February urged Lebanon’s political parties to put the national interest first and speed up the formation of a new government.

The emir voiced his remarks during a meeting with Hariri in Doha.
